''Christ’s Second Coming, Is It Pre-Millennial Or Post-Millennial?'' is a book written by Richard Cunningham Shimeall in 1866. The book explores the theological debate surrounding the timing of Christ’s second coming, specifically whether it will occur before or after the millennium. Shimeall presents arguments from both sides of the debate and provides a thorough analysis of biblical passages related to the topic. The book also includes historical perspectives on the debate and evaluates the implications of each position for Christian faith and practice.
